iOSinstaller
iOSinstaller is a macOS utility that facilitates the installation and management of iOS or iPadOS systems on compatible Apple devices from a Mac. It is used primarily by developers, advanced users, and iOS enthusiasts who need to restore, update, or downgrade iOS versions on iPhones, iPads, or other iOS devices. The app provides a streamlined interface for handling iOS firmware files and device restoration workflows, often serving as an alternative to Apple's official Finder restoration process or iTunes for users requiring more control or flexibility.
